15:07:54 <d34dh0r53> #startmeeting keystone 15:07:54 <opendevmeet> Meeting started Tue Apr 18 15:07:54 2023 UTC and is due to finish in 60 minutes. The chair is d34dh0r53. Information about MeetBot at http://wiki.debian.org/MeetBot. 15:07:54 <opendevmeet>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 15:07:54 <opendevmeet> The meeting name has been set to 'keystone' 15:08:05 <d34dh0r53> #topic roll call 15:08:14 <xek> o/ 15:08:14 <d34dh0r53> admiyo, bbobrov, crisloma, d34dh0r53, dpar, dstanek, hrybacki, knikolla[m], lbragstad, lwanderley, kmalloc, rodrigods, samueldmq, ruan_he, wxy, sonuk, vishakha, Ajay, rafaelwe, xek, gmann, zaitcev, arequate, dmendiza[m] 15:08:15 <dmendiza[m]> 🙋 15:08:19 <d34dh0r53> o/ sorry I'm late 15:08:51 <zaitcev> at least you made it 15:09:12 <d34dh0r53> #link https://etherpad.opendev.org/p/keystone-weekly-meeting 15:09:15 <d34dh0r53> :) 15:09:57 <d34dh0r53> #topic review past meeting work items 15:10:02 <d34dh0r53> first up d34dh0r53 look into the keystone-groups members as well https://review.opendev.org/admin/groups/d7203dc55fa9bdf98c578b16ac398e0c754a1a67,members not sure if it's used any more 15:10:39 <d34dh0r53> we talked about this at the PTG, we're going to make all of the groups inherit from the keystone-core group which should simplify our groups 15:11:07 <d34dh0r53> dmendiza[m]: did you get a chance to update the groups? 15:11:20 <dmendiza[m]> d34dh0r53: negative 15:11:24 <d34dh0r53> we had started looking at it when my internet went down for the day 15:11:46 <d34dh0r53> dmendiza[m]: ack, maybe we can do that on Friday? 15:11:58 <dmendiza[m]> Yeah, let's do it 15:12:10 <d34dh0r53> #action dmendiza[m], d34dh0r53 update the keystone groups to inherit from keystone-core 15:12:16 <d34dh0r53> sweet 15:12:36 <d34dh0r53> next up was d34dh0r53 investigate https://bugs.launchpad.net/keystone/+bug/2009752 15:12:57 <d34dh0r53> I haven't had a chance to do this, but I am working on an environment in which I can test this out this week 15:13:01 <d34dh0r53> #action d34dh0r53 investigate https://bugs.launchpad.net/keystone/+bug/2009752 15:13:25 <d34dh0r53> #topic liaison updates 15:13:35 <d34dh0r53> nothing from VMT 15:13:55 <dmendiza[m]> nothing from Release either ... ( i think I'm a release liaison anyway ) 15:14:04 <d34dh0r53> I need to work with fungi to close out a couple of keystone issues that have been fixed 15:14:10 <d34dh0r53> dmendiza[m]: I have you down as one ;) 15:14:37 <d34dh0r53> as always if anyone is interested in being a liaison please reach out to me 15:14:44 <d34dh0r53> next up we have 15:14:56 <d34dh0r53> #topic specification OAuth 2.0 (hiromu) 15:15:11 <d34dh0r53> #link https://review.opendev.org/q/topic:bp%252Foauth2-client-credentials-ext 15:15:13 <d34dh0r53> External OAuth 2.0 Specification 15:15:15 <d34dh0r53> #link https://review.opendev.org/c/openstack/keystone-specs/+/861554 15:15:17 <d34dh0r53> OAuth 2.0 Implementation 15:15:19 <d34dh0r53> #link https://review.opendev.org/q/topic:bp%252Fsupport-oauth2-mtls 15:15:21 <d34dh0r53> OAuth 2.0 Documentation 15:15:23 <d34dh0r53> #link https://review.opendev.org/c/openstack/keystone/+/838108 15:15:25 <d34dh0r53> #link https://review.opendev.org/c/openstack/keystoneauth/+/838104 15:15:33 <d34dh0r53> I know work is ongoing on this, but I haven't been able to follow closely 15:17:20 <d34dh0r53> I don't think Hiromu is around today, so we'll move on unless anyone else has comments 15:17:43 <d34dh0r53> #topic specification Secure RBAC (dmendiza[m]) 15:18:23 <dmendiza[m]> No updates, sorry. I've been busy with downstream things. 15:18:32 <d34dh0r53> Yep, I understand. Thanks! 15:18:50 <d34dh0r53> #topic specification SQLAlchemy 2.0 (stephenfin) 15:19:00 <d34dh0r53> we need reviews on these patches 15:19:15 <d34dh0r53> #link https://review.opendev.org/q/topic:sqlalchemy-20+is:open+project:openstack/keystone 15:19:33 <d34dh0r53> I think those might be good fodder for the reviewathon 15:20:01 <d34dh0r53> cool, next up we have 15:20:08 <d34dh0r53> #topic open discussion 15:20:22 <d34dh0r53> (drencrom) We need to merge and backport this patch #link https://review.opendev.org/c/openstack/keystonemiddleware/+/877808 to fix pep8 tests 15:20:38 <d34dh0r53> please vote on the backports when you get a chance 15:21:55 <d34dh0r53> and next up we have more backports to review: 15:21:57 <d34dh0r53> (mustafakemalgilor) PooledLdapHandler message.clean() patch backports 15:21:59 <d34dh0r53> review request 15:22:01 <d34dh0r53> #link ussuri: https://review.opendev.org/c/openstack/keystone/+/874846 15:22:03 <d34dh0r53> #link victoria: https://review.opendev.org/c/openstack/keystone/+/874847 15:22:05 <d34dh0r53> #link wallaby: https://review.opendev.org/c/openstack/keystone/+/874844 15:22:07 <d34dh0r53> #link xena: https://review.opendev.org/c/openstack/keystone/+/874843 15:22:31 <d34dh0r53> take a look at those when you get a chance as well, we'll look at backports during the reviewathon too 15:22:47 <d34dh0r53> any this else before we move on to bug review? 15:22:59 <d34dh0r53> *thing 15:25:39 <d34dh0r53> cool 15:25:46 <d34dh0r53> #topic bug review 15:25:57 <d34dh0r53> #link https://bugs.launchpad.net/keystone/?orderby=-id&start=0 15:26:31 <d34dh0r53> #link https://bugs.launchpad.net/keystone/+bug/2013473 15:26:57 <d34dh0r53> yeah, that is a problem, looks like tkajinam has it, reach out if you need anything 15:27:46 <d34dh0r53> that's all for Keystone 15:27:49 <d34dh0r53> next up we have 15:28:03 <d34dh0r53> #link https://bugs.launchpad.net/python-keystoneclient/?orderby=-id&start=0 15:28:19 <d34dh0r53> nothing new 15:28:23 <d34dh0r53> #link https://bugs.launchpad.net/keystoneauth/+bugs?orderby=-id&start=0 15:29:07 <d34dh0r53> #link https://bugs.launchpad.net/keystoneauth/+bug/2012047 15:29:17 <d34dh0r53> that is a new bug, any volunteers to look at it? 15:31:09 <d34dh0r53> ok, moving on 15:31:28 <d34dh0r53> #link https://bugs.launchpad.net/keystonemiddleware/+bugs?orderby=-id&start=0 15:31:51 <d34dh0r53> #link https://bugs.launchpad.net/keystonemiddleware/+bug/2015334 15:31:57 <d34dh0r53> that is a new bug 15:32:45 <d34dh0r53> it looks like pshchelo has a patch up for it, please review when you get a chance 15:32:56 <d34dh0r53> #link https://review.opendev.org/c/openstack/keystonemiddleware/+/879503 15:33:16 <d34dh0r53> next up is pycadf 15:33:31 <d34dh0r53> #link https://bugs.launchpad.net/pycadf/+bugs?orderby=-id&start=0 15:33:48 <d34dh0r53> no new bugs for pycadf 15:33:50 <d34dh0r53> and finally 15:33:54 <d34dh0r53> #link https://bugs.launchpad.net/ldappool/+bugs?orderby=-id&start=0 15:34:01 <d34dh0r53> no new bugs for pycadf 15:34:06 <d34dh0r53> err ldappool 15:34:16 <d34dh0r53> that does it for bug review 15:34:22 <d34dh0r53> #topic conclusion 15:34:46 <d34dh0r53> thanks everyone, reminder that the reviewathon is Friday at 14:00 UTC, an hour earlier than it's been 15:35:01 <d34dh0r53> Please reach out of you need anything from me or one of the cores 15:35:12 <d34dh0r53> Have a great rest of your week :) 15:35:18 <d34dh0r53> #endmeeting